Pavement milling services involve the removal of the top layer of an existing asphalt or concrete surface. This process uses specialized equipment to grind down the pavement, creating a smooth, even base for future repairs or resurfacing. Milling is often performed to eliminate surface imperfections such as ruts, cracks, and uneven areas, helping to restore the integrity of the pavement before new material is applied. It is a practical solution for preparing driveways, parking lots, and roadways for a fresh layer of asphalt or concrete, ensuring a more durable and long-lasting finish.
This service is particularly effective in addressing common pavement problems like surface deterioration, aging, and damage caused by heavy traffic or weather conditions. Over time, surfaces can develop cracks, potholes, or unevenness that compromise safety and aesthetics. Milling removes these damaged layers, preventing issues from worsening and reducing the need for complete reconstruction. It also provides a clean, stable foundation for the next phase of pavement repair, which can extend the lifespan of the entire surface and improve its overall appearance.

The overview below groups typical Pavement Milling Service proj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Denver County, CO.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or pavement milling projects, such as patching small sections or surface leveling, generally range from $250-$600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, depending on the size and complexity of the area.
Mid-Size Projects - Larger, more involved milling tasks like partial removal or resurfacing can cost between $1,000-$3,000. These projects are common for commercial properties or larger driveways in Denver County and nearby areas.
Full Pavement Removal - Complete removal and replacement of pavement often start around $4,000 and can go beyond $8,000 for extensive areas. Fewer projects reach the highest tiers, which are typically reserved for large-scale or complex jobs.
Industrial or Large-Scale Jobs - Very large or specialized milling projects, such as airport runways or extensive roadways, can exceed $20,000. These are less common and usually involve multiple service providers or extensive planning.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is pavement milling? Pavement milling involves removing the top layer of a damaged or worn asphalt surface to prepare it for resurfacing or repairs, helping to restore a smooth and even driving surface.
Why should I consider pavement milling for my driveway or parking lot? Pavement milling can effectively eliminate surface imperfections, cracks, and raveling, providing a solid foundation for new asphalt layers and extending the lifespan of the pavement.
What types of surfaces can be treated with pavement milling? Pavement milling is suitable for various surfaces, including driveways, parking lots, roads, and other asphalt pavements that require surface removal or leveling.
How do local contractors typically perform pavement milling? Local service providers typically use specialized milling machines to precisely remove designated layers of asphalt, ensuring a clean, even surface ready for subsequent paving or repairs.
What are common reasons to choose pavement milling over complete removal? Milling is often preferred when only the surface layer needs replacement or leveling, as it is less invasive and can be a cost-effective way to address surface issues without full pavement removal.
